Veil Node.js SDK
A comprehensive TypeScript/JavaScript SDK for the Veil API Gateway Management Server. This SDK provides a simple and intuitive interface for managing API configurations, API keys, and routing through the Veil Caddy module.

API Reference
Client Configuration
interface VeilClientOptions {
baseUrl?: string; // Default: 'http://localhost:2020'
timeout?: number; // Default: 30000ms
headers?: Record<string, string>; // Additional headers
}API Management
Onboard API
await client.onboardAPI({
path: '/api/*',
upstream: 'http://localhost:8080/api',
required_subscription: 'premium',
methods: ['GET', 'POST'],
required_headers: ['Authorization'],
api_keys: [{
key: 'api-key-123',
name: 'Production Key',
is_active: true
}]
});Update API
await client.updateAPI('/api/*', {
path: '/api/*',
upstream: 'http://localhost:8081/api',
methods: ['GET', 'POST', 'PUT'],
// ... other fields
});Partial Update API
await client.patchAPI('/api/*', {
upstream: 'http://localhost:8082/api'
});Delete API
await client.deleteAPI('/api/*');API Key Management
Add API Keys
await client.addAPIKeys({
path: '/api/*',
api_keys: [{
key: 'new-key-456',
name: 'New API Key',
is_active: true
}]
});Update API Key Status
await client.updateAPIKeyStatus({
path: '/api/*',
api_key: 'api-key-123',
is_active: false
});Delete API Key
await client.deleteAPIKey({
path: '/api/*',
api_key: 'api-key-123'
});Error Handling
The SDK provides comprehensive error handling through the VeilError class:
import { VeilError } from '@veil/nodejs-sdk';
try {
await client.onboardAPI(apiConfig);
} catch (error) {
if (error instanceof VeilError) {
console.error('Veil API Error:', error.message);
console.error('Status Code:', error.status);
console.error('Response:', error.response);
} else {
console.error('Unexpected error:', error);
}
}Examples

};Architecture
The Veil system operates on two main ports:
- Port 2020: Management API for onboarding and configuration (this SDK)
- Port 2021: Proxied APIs with validation and key authentication
This SDK interacts with the management API (port 2020) to configure the gateway. Your applications will then make requests to the proxied APIs (port 2021) using the configured API keys.
